Game Recap: Men's Water Polo |

'Birds Drop Heartbreaker to Eagles

FRESNO, Calif. - The Fresno Pacific Sunbirds conceded a heart-breaking final minute goal to the Biola Eagles to fall 15-14 Friday night at the Sunnyside Aquatics Center. 

The game opened with two straight goals from the Eagles, before Eugenio Maldonado answered off the power play to put the Sunbirds on the board for the first goal of the night. 

Back-to-back goals from the Eagles and the Sunbirds kept the Biola lead at one until Christian Clark on the next Sunbird possession found the back of the net to give the game it's first tie at 3-3. 

The 2nd period began with both teams trading turnovers. 

In the 6th and 5th minute, Biola capitalized on two straight chances to retake the lead 5-3. 

Out of a timeout and off a power play, Maldonado scored his second goal of the game off the assist from Pietro Cattano to bring the 'Birds back within one. 

Biola and Fresno Pacific would both convert on their next two possessions, allowing the Eagles would maintain the one goal 8-7 lead heading into the half. 

In their first possession of the 3rd, the Sunbird's Scott Tashima scored off the power play to tie the game 8-8. 

A saved five-meter penalty shot by Ethan McLaughlin set the 'Birds up on the next play to take their first lead of the game as William Green scored his first goal of the game off the assist by Forrest Gray

The lead was short lived as the Eagles countered back to tie the game 9-9. 

Maldonado would add to his score sheet with back-back goals to give the Sunbirds their largest lead of the game at two heading into the final minutes of the 3rd period. 

Off a power play in the last two minutes, the Eagles scored to end the 3rd 11-10.

Forrest Gray opened the 4th period with his first goal of the match.

The Eagles answered with two goals to tie the score 12-12 in the 5th minute. 

A pair of goals from both teams kept the score knotted heading into the final minutes of the game. 

In the 3rd minute, Maldonado converted off the power play for his sixth goal of the match to bring the 'Birds back up one.

Biola answered quickly off a power play of their own to keep the game tied at 14-14 with two minutes left. 

Both teams would trade a pair of turnovers, until with 30 seconds left the Sunbirds were called for an exclusion giving the Eagles another power play. 

The Eagles would convert with 20 seconds left taking their first lead of the game since the 2nd period. 

In the final seconds, Gray attempt a shot but the Eagle's Mitchell Carpenter made the save to end the game and thwart the 'Birds upset bid.

Seven Sunbirds scored with Maldonado leading the way with six.

Green ended the night with two goals, four assists, and three steals, one of his best performances of the season.
